A Metal Embossing Machine Line is a metal forming process unit that emboss a series of straight or parallel ridges onto a metal sheet or strip.
Metal Embossing Machine Line
A Metal coil embossing line is a stamping process to produce various designed patterns in metal sheet by passing the sheet in roll or a strip of metal between rolls of the desired patterns. The thickness of the sheet is from 0.2mm to 5.0mm.
For the metal embossing machine, we could design for you as single embossing machine. Or part of roll forming line. Or a embossing line which is consist of Uncoiler, Embossing Machine, Recoiler.
Although some embossed patterns are simply decorative, one major benefit is that embossing increases the strength-to-weight ratio of the formed sheet metal.
The users can buy light gauge metal sheet and then embossed to provide adequate strength requirements. Embossing can be done by either stamping or rolling. And the rolling method is faster, as it uses mating pairs of rotary tooling to do the embossing, thus completing the task at a much higher speed.
